What are the most common Toyota repairs needed by drivers in the Collinsville, CT area?

Given our local climate with cold winters and road salt use, common repairs for Collinsville Toyotas include brake system corrosion, exhaust issues, and undercarriage rust prevention. For older models, like the Camry or Corolla, we frequently address suspension wear from our varied terrain and pothole-ridden roads after winter.

How can I find a reputable, independent shop for Toyota repair in Collinsville versus going to a dealership?

Look for a Collinsville or Canton Valley shop with ASE-certified technicians who specialize in Japanese makes and use genuine or high-quality aftermarket Toyota parts. Checking local reviews and asking if they have specific diagnostic tools for Toyota systems, like Techstream software, is key for quality independent service.

What local driving conditions should influence my Toyota's maintenance schedule in Collinsville?

The hilly terrain, frequent short trips common in the area, and harsh winter conditions mean you should adhere strictly to severe service schedules. This includes more frequent oil changes, tire rotations, and brake inspections to combat the wear from stop-and-go driving on Route 179 and corrosion from road salt.
